One such example of how cultural diversity is celebrated through lighting in Israel is the annual Jerusalem Festival of light. This vibrant event showcases light installations created by artists from around the world, each drawing inspiration from their own cultural backgrounds. From interactive light displays to immersive installations, the festival brings together artists and spectators to celebrate the diversity of light and creativity. In addition to these large-scale events, everyday life in Israel is also infused with cultural diversity through lighting. From traditional Jewish menorahs to colorful lanterns used in Arab festivals, lighting plays a crucial role in commemorating different cultural events and traditions.
